Reisberg, Leo – Chronicle of Higher Education, 1999
Enrollments at evangelical and other Christian colleges have surged in the last decade, outpacing that of secular institutions. The students, many from home schooling or church-operated schools, want to avoid lifestyles found at many secular colleges and universities. Some critics, however, fear lack of diversity in both enrollments and opinions…

Merck, Edwin J. – Trusteeship, 1998
In response to widespread frustration over faculty salary negotiations, Wheaton College (Massachusetts) linked faculty salaries to changes in its financial resources. The policy united the entire college community and paid dividends in many ways. Faculty have become more directly involved in fundraising and recruitment activities, and in the…
